    he he i think the issue is to look deep and deeper

    when you look on upper balls (these which can be used to focus on SG)
    you can overlay the nearest ones but if you cross your eyes stronger you can overlay next balls so
    in the first approach you can see ball 8 as designed by gary
    in the second approach you can see 4 eyed worm (as we can see two 8s touching eachother)

    i'll try to see even more deeper and i'll tel you what i see

    edit:
    well it's really hard to see the third picture
    as we try to see SG we need to set focus on "deep space" so in fact we set our eyes to look more ahead (i don't know if it's understandable) - we see ball 8
    now looking on second picture (4 eyed worm) we need to set eyes to see even more ahead so they look almost parallelly
    and reaching even more we need to spread our eyes... there is no mechanism in out brain to command eyes to look left and right in the same time

    reasumming:
    i can focus on the third picture but only on upper balls
    my eyes are set so wide so i loose focus when i move eyes on the main part of the screen

    is anybody who can see third picture?

    Pixel - I'm not sure what the third image is that you are seeing? I only designed the 8-ball which is on a kind of stage. But that's about it.

    Here's the depth image. That's all that is back there that I am aware of.

    I have also provided the repeating pattern. I created the colored 8 Ball and then created a blend with the Alt Rainbow option to create a rainbow of objects. About 200. When one of the 8 balls goes off one edge of the square tile, it comes in at the opposite edge. This is mind numbingly tedious, but what else do I have to do?
